What is Sensitivity Analysis?

Sensitivity analysis is a technique used to determine how changes in variables affect the outcome of a valuation model. In the context of residual valuation, sensitivity analysis helps to identify the most critical variables that impact the estimated land value.

Why is Sensitivity Analysis Important?

Sensitivity analysis is crucial in residual valuation because it:

  • Helps to identify the key drivers of the land value
  • Allows for the testing of different scenarios and assumptions
  • Provides a range of possible outcomes, rather than a single point estimate
  • Enables the identification of areas of uncertainty and risk

Steps in Conducting Sensitivity Analysis

To conduct a sensitivity analysis in residual valuation:

  1. Identify key variables: Determine the variables that have the greatest impact on the land value, such as construction costs, rental yields, and discount rates.
  2. Establish a base case: Establish a base case scenario with a set of assumed values for each variable.
  3. Vary variables: Vary each key variable individually, while holding all other variables constant, to assess the impact on the estimated land value.
  4. Analyze results: Analyze the results to determine the sensitivity of the land value to changes in each variable.

Tips for Conducting Sensitivity Analysis

  • Use realistic ranges: Use realistic and plausible ranges for each variable to ensure that the analysis is meaningful.
  • Consider multiple scenarios: Consider multiple scenarios to capture a range of possible outcomes.
  • Prioritize variables: Prioritize variables based on their impact on the land value to focus on the most critical variables.

Interpreting Sensitivity Analysis Results

When interpreting the results of a sensitivity analysis:

  • Identify key drivers: Identify the variables that have the greatest impact on the land value.
  • Assess uncertainty: Assess the uncertainty associated with each variable and its impact on the land value.
  • Consider scenario planning: Consider scenario planning to anticipate potential outcomes and develop strategies to manage risk.
